Transaction 35462f781736f78bf82c24f162221317c00d3a7e8b170e55e34b60a5043bbfea

1 Input
2 Outputs
  • 35462f781736f78bf82c24f162221317c00d3a7e8b170e55e34b60a5043bbfea:0
  • value  466504
    address  385LLBhmNArgYcW5D59uArdzjVEfjHkWY1
  • 35462f781736f78bf82c24f162221317c00d3a7e8b170e55e34b60a5043bbfea:1
  • value  17328570
    address  3Mn8wdTF9frMTHPfRajk8a59io7mijbUtD